Description

A very attractive and well appointed individual detached chalet style residence enjoying lovely views and sea glimpses in a private and peaceful setting, just 15 minutes’ walk of Lyme Regis town centre. EPC: C

The Property - The Old Orchard is an attractive, spacious and well appointed, individual detached residence, enjoying views over the Wood Valley and sea glimpses, in a private and peaceful setting, yet within just 15 minutes’ walk of Lyme Regis town centre and the seafront. It was traditionally built in the 1980s, having reconstituted stone-faced elevations and, under the current ownership since 2022, it has been subject to extensive improvement and upgrading to a very high standard.

The house is well appointed with many excellent amenities including gas-fired central heating, tiled fireplace with wood burner, plus underfloor heating to the kitchen/dining room, woodgrain style uPVC sealed unit windows/doors, quality bespoke German Kessebohmer kitchen with extensive quartz worktops/breakfast bar and quality Neff appliances with twin ovens, large induction hob and cooker hood, slate flooring to the kitchen/dining room, two quality wet rooms (the largest featuring freestanding roll top bath and Jack and Jill doors to the principal bedroom), neutral quality fitted carpets and remote control garage door. high quialiy, durable, sisal looking flooring from the unnatural flooring company and remote

The accommodation is well presented and spacious, extending to around 1511sqft. All of the principal rooms face west, enjoying the wonderful views over Lyme Regis, Wood Valley and down to the sea.

The accommodation extends to:

Ground floor - Reception hall, bedroom 4/study, living room, utility/WC, through kitchen/dining room with patio doors to balcony.

First floor - Landing, principal bedroom with interconnecting door to bathroom/wet room, two further double bedrooms, second wet room.

The property also benefits from extensive recent landscaping works to create attractive gardens together with good off-road parking, integral double garage and orangery.

Outside - The house is approached over a private and no-through lane and is set well back with a large tarmac driveway with parking area leading to the integral double garage and adjoining orangery.

The gardens are a further feature, being attractively laid out and landscaped with timber decking, paved pathways, gravelled areas, raised beds and vegetable patch plus terracing. There is also a greenhouse and shed.

At the rear is a pedestrian gate onto Talbot Road.

Situation - The Old Orchard enjoys a very peaceful and tucked away position, just off Colway Lane, a sought after and well established residential area on the northeast side of the picturesque coastal town of Lyme Regis. The town centre and esplanade are within only about 15 minutes’ walk. Lyme Regis is a historic coastal town offering a wide range of shopping and leisure facilities including sailing, diving, fishing, golf and bowling. The town also has a theatre and is well served by several medical and dental practices, excellent local schools and is within easy reach of the renowned Colyton Grammer School. To the north is the market town of Axminster with mainline station on the Waterloo line. Lyme Regis golf course is within only about 10 minutes’ walk.
